This laminar fluid study investigates the effects of a magnetic field on the entropy generation during fluid flow and heat transfer due to an exponentially stretching sheet. Using the suitable transformations we have obtained the analytical solutions for momentum and energy equation in terms of Kummer's function. The velocity and temperature profiles are obtained for various physical parameters which are utilized to find the entropy generation number Ns and the Bejan number Be. The effects of various parameters on entropy production number and the Bejan number are studied through graphs using velocity and temperature profiles. © 2013 Wiley Periodicals, Inc. 13CP/MAS NMR spectroscopic studies of some starches from cereals (wheat, maize and finger millet), pulses (green gram, chick pea), tuber (potato) and root (tapioca), and their respective acid (HCI, HNO3) modified starches were carried out. While cereal starches exhibited a triplet signal for their anomeric carbons, pulse, tuber and root starches showed doublets. Line width changes in signals indicated that debranching in the above modified starches led to narrowing of C6 signals (more pronounced in the case of potato and tapioca starches) and were consistent with the release of branching strains. Potato starch, both native and modified, was found to be different from other starches as inferred from the chemical shift values for their anomeric carbons and line shape. The dihedral angle (ϕ′2) calculated from chemical shift values for C1 and conformation of dihedral angel (x) as predicted from chemical shift of C6 are discussed with respect to structural organization.  相似文献

The theory of noise-alone-reference (NAR) power estimation is extended to the estimation of spatial covariance matrices. A NAR covariance estimator insensitive to signal presence is derived. The SNR (signal-to-noise ratio) loss incurred by using this estimator is independent of the input SNR and is less than that encountered with the maximum likelihood covariance estimator given that the same number of uncorrelated snapshots is available to both estimators. The analysis assumes first a deterministic signal. The results are extended and generalized to signals with unknown parameters or random signals. For the random signal case, generalized and quasi-NAR covariance estimators are presented  相似文献

Hardware implementation of artificial neural networks has been attracting great attention recently. In this work, the analog VLSI implementation of artificial neural networks by using only transconductors is presented. The signal flow graph approach is used in synthesis. The neural flow graph is defined. Synthesis of various neural network configurations by means of neural flow graph is described. The approach presented in this work is technology independent. This approach can be applied to new neural network topologies to be proposed or used with transconductors designed in future technologies.  相似文献

In this paper, a near-triangular buried-oxide partial silicon-on-insulator (TB-PSOI) lateral double-diffused MOS field-effect transistor is proposed. The electric field and electrostatic potential in this structure are modified by the gradual buried-oxide thickness increase. The modification includes the addition of a new peak in the electric field in comparison to that of the conventional PSOI. To assess the efficiency of the proposed structure, its breakdown voltage is compared with that of conventional PSOI using two-dimensional simulations. A comparative study is performed in terms of silicon-film and buried-oxide layer thicknesses, drift region and buried-oxide layer lengths, and drift region doping concentrations. The study shows that under the same drain current, the breakdown voltage of TB-PSOI is nearly two times higher than its PSOI counterpart (108% improvement). Simulation results show that the three-stepped oxide layer closely follows the TB-PSOI structure with a breakdown voltage improvement of 96% compared to that of the PSOI structure.  相似文献

In this paper, a generalized hydrodynamic model that includes four conservation equations for a general, position-dependent energy band structure and effective mass is presented. An analytical mobility model is extended to simulate two-valley semiconductor devices. A semiconductor device simulation package, DYNA, is introduced. Simulation results for both bulk materials and submicron-gate GaAs MESFETs show good agreement with experimental data and Monte Carlo device simulation results.  相似文献

Using the physical optics approximation, the radar image of a target can be constructed from a knowledge of the monostatic backscattered field or hologram for all frequencies and all aspects angles. The target image is the two-dimensional Fourier transform of the hologram. This is based on the same principle as conventional holography. In the near-field the image is computed by the coherent summation of back-projected range responses which are derived from complex impulse responses. Consequently, the image can be interpreted as a tomographic reconstruction. If the target is within the antenna beam at each radar position in the linear synthetic-aperture radar (SAR) geometry, then the algorithm for the coherent summation of impulse response derivatives (IRDs) can be applied. Experimental results for the near-field of a wheat field and a Peugeot 504 automobile are presented to verify the effectiveness of the method  相似文献
